On 1 July 1941, the 502nd Parachute Infantry Battalion was activated at Fort Benning, GA.
This new unit was initially composed of two skeleton companies from the 501st. "The Deuce" jumped into Normandy, Market Garden, and fought in the Battle of the Bulge. CaptainĀ Frank Lillyman, officer in charge of the regiment's pathfinder platoon, was the first American jumper of the night - celebrated as the first American paratrooper to drop behind German lines in the Allied invasion of Normandy.
